2. Emerging Solar Panel Technologies



The efficiency of photovoltaic panels has come a long way over the last few years, yet there are still plenty of chances for enhancement. Emerging photovoltaic panel technologies have the potential to reinvent the industry and make solar power even more easily accessible for people around the world. Take Aiko Power's ingenious new bifacial photovoltaic panel, for example. This item makes use of two panels instead of one, enabling it to soak up light from both sides and create as much as 30% more power than conventional single-panel systems.

Various other emerging innovations consist of clear solar batteries that can be put on windows and constructing facades, as well as paintable solar batteries that can be utilized to turn any kind of surface into an energy-generating asset. These materials offer interesting possibilities for making existing structures much more energy efficient without needing additional room or building and construction work. In addition, they could be utilized in places like deserts and various other remote areas that do not have accessibility to traditional grid infrastructure.

3. The Effect Of Solar Panels On The Environment



The impact of photovoltaic panels on the environment is extensively talked about, and forever factor. This makes it an appealing option to other forms of energy production.

However, photovoltaic panels still have ecological influences. They need products to make, which can entail mining and chemical use that can be harming to the atmosphere. They also use up a lot of area, so they may cause habitat loss or devastation when mounted in areas with sensitive ecological communities. In addition, they require upkeep to maintain them working effectively, which can cause squander generation or water pollution if done incorrectly. Generally, photovoltaic panels are an environmentally friendly alternative when made use of responsibly and meticulously took care of.
